J Ethnopharmacol. 2000 Nov; 73(1-2): 47-51.

Pharmacological activity of Abies pindrow.

Singh RK, Bhattacharya SK, Acharya SB.

Department of Pharmacology, Institute of Medical Sciences, Banaras Hindu University, 221005, Varanasi, India.

The widely known tree Abies pindrow (Talisapatra) (family: Pinaceae), famous for its diverse clinical uses in Ayurvedic medicines, was investigated to rationalise some of the ancient claims. The petroleum ether (PE), benzene (BE), chloroform (CE), acetone (AE) and ethanol (EE) extracts of A. pindrow leaf were found to have mast cell stabilizing action in rats. The EE, AE and BE extracts offered bronchoprotection against histamine challenge in guinea-pigs. The BE, CE and PE extracts had protective role in aspirin-induced ulcer in rats. The results suggest that while terpenoids, flavonoids, glycosides and steroids are involved in mast cell protection, terpenoids and flavonoids are brochoprotective against histamine-induced bronchospasm. The ulcer protective action of PE, BE and CE fractions of A. pindrow may be attributable to steroids contents only because though all the extracts tested positive for glycosides, the extracts EE and AE did not have any ulcer protective role.
